Benefits, employee involvement, work environment, diverse collection of people, multiple offices, travel.
eShares has problems in several aspects of their culture. Most notably, their no-feedback policy. I saw many talented people get let go because their managers would not provide them guidance into how they can add value to the firm. This created an odd environment where managers were not engaged in what their employees were doing. Upper management is incredibly cliquish, and blatant favoritism runs rampant.
Push managers to be more active in their roles rather than have them solely as performance assessors.
